Google is committing €13 billion ($15 billion) across Finland, marking its largest single capital expenditure in Europe to date. Rather than a routine server refresh, this staggering capital allocation is engineered specifically to feed the compute-hungry infrastructure behind models like Gemini. The aggressive roadmap targets four municipalities, doubling down on its flagship hub while establishing new outposts.
As Antti Jarvinen, Google's director for Finland, explained to AFP, the strategic footprint is rapidly widening beyond its historical coastal presence:
"Now we are building more in Hamina, expanding that site on a remarkable level, and we are opening up data center operations in three new locations in the municipalities of Kajaani, Muhos and Vaala,"
Construction is slated for 2027 and 2028, with Google projecting an annual €3.6 billion contribution to Finnish GDP and 37,000 supported jobs during construction. Once operational, the sites will sustain roughly 7,000 ongoing roles.
Power Constraints and Infrastructure Defense
The real battle here is energy access. With the EU tightening environmental standards and global power grids facing acute capacity shortages, hyperscalers are racing to corner predictable, low-carbon Nordic energy. Fingrid, Finland's national transmission system operator, projects a 40% surge in domestic electricity consumption driven primarily by the data center rush. Meanwhile, the Finnish Security and Intelligence Service (Supo) has flagged potential security vulnerabilities tied to foreign-controlled computing hubs.
To lock down its energy moat before regional capacity tightens further, Google orchestrated a 22-year clean energy supply contract with Finnish utility Fortum. By securing long-term power purchase agreements decades in advance, Big Tech is driving up infrastructure capex baselines across the board and converting Northern Europe into a computational fortress—effectively boxing out enterprise players lacking sovereign-scale balance sheets.
